John Lewis & Partners
John Lewis & Partners is a department retailer and supermarket chain in the United Kingdom. The stores offer a wide variety of goods such as lighting and furniture, Christmas gifting cosmetics, clothing and shoes. In addition, the business provides fashion-related advice without charge to customers, with no commitment to buy. John Lewis & Partners offers credit and insurance services. The company's headquarters is in London, England.
Established in 1864, John Lewis Partnership is Britain's oldest and largest example of worker co-ownership and all employees are considered more than employees. They are Partners, with shares of the business held in trust for them by the Partnership and a share in the profits and know-how of the business. This democratic ethos that is at the core of the company's culture as well as customer service is what distinguishes it from other retailers in the UK.
The first John Lewis store opened in Oxford Street in London in 1864, and has since grown to a network of 35 stores across Great Britain, with 12 dedicated to John Lewis at Home. It also has an online store and numerous John Lewis concessions, including one in Dublin's Arnotts department store. The company is a member of the Waitrose Group and has bought several independent stores.

G Plan
Before you make a purchase you must consider a variety of factors. Choose whether you would prefer a fabric or leather sofa. Fabric is available in a wide variety of styles and textures including velvet and Boucle. Leather is easier to clean and is more durable. It is recommended to choose a fabric that is stain-resistant if you have children. If you're on a budget, choose a sofa that is able to be removed and machine washed to save money.
The G-Plan brand of furniture was created in the 1950s by E Gomme Ltd., which was a company with its headquarters in High Wycombe. The light oak furniture was a departure for the utilitarian styles at the time and was a huge hit with customers. The collection was also unique in that it allowed customers to buy pieces bit by bit, the first'mix-and match' furniture. G-Plan became one of the most successful furniture manufacturers in the UK and its range was copied by other manufacturers.

Maker & Son
Maker & Son, an online furniture retailer in the UK produces high-end sofas made of sustainable materials. Founded by Alex Willcock and Felix Conran, the grandson of Terence Conran, it has more than 150 employees. Its unique business model is to deliver its products directly to the customer by using mobile showrooms. These vans resemble living rooms, and they provide a wide range of fabrics and colours to pick from.

IKEA
IKEA is well known for its low-priced furniture and furniture for homes. Its stores feature a directed walking path that leads shoppers through nearly all of its stock (provided they don't take the shortcuts available). The goal of IKEA is to offer customers a an extensive selection of products at prices so low that they are able to buy them without worrying about their budget.
IKEA was founded in 1943 by Swedish entrepreneur Ingvar Kamprad. In its early days, it sold watches, pens and stockings, but the company soon shifted its focus to furniture. The majority of its products are available in flat-pack format that allows customers to put them together. This helps reduce the cost of shipping and waste packaging. Furthermore, this process allows for more storage space in trucks and trains.
The company's ethos is that a well-designed product should be accessible to many people. To accomplish this, it uses a unique business model and utilizes tax loopholes to keep prices as low as is possible. Its status as a non-profit allows it to reinvest profits into its business.
